5 benefits of private prenatal yoga
There are many benefits of doing yoga while pregnant. It will open up your hips, teach you how to breathe, strengthen your muscles and help combat stress. In fact, there are actual studies that prove that yoga is great to not only help you while you are pregnant, but also while giving birth.
There are numerous yoga studios that offer prenatal yoga classes in the GTA, but this doesn’t mean that these classes are the right choice for you. There are actually many reasons why they may not be, and why private prenatal yoga sessions are the better choice. Here are the benefits of doing private prenatal yoga classes.

They are designed specifically for you
In a group prenatal yoga class, the class is designed so that anyone at any level can join. They are also open to mothers at any stage in their pregnancy, so you will have people in the class in their first, second and third trimesters. This isn’t necessarily a bad thing, but it also means that the class is not designed for you. When you do private yoga sessions they are designed specifically for you and your needs. Private classes take into consideration what stage you are in your pregnancy, and are modified each week as you progress further into your pregnancy. As well, if you have any injuries, these can be properly accommodated.
They go at your pace
If you have years of yoga experience and don’t want to do the gentle stretching and slow breathing that many prenatal yoga classes offer, private prenatal yoga is great for you. Prenatal yoga doesn’t have to be slow paced. It can be just as vigorous as it was before you were pregnant, within reason, of course. You can still continue to do much of what you did before you became pregnant, making modifications as your tummy gets bigger. The same is true if you are an absolute beginner and are doing yoga for the first time. A program will be designed for you and at the pace that you need.
